Deleting a mirror
When you delete a mirror, all of the pairs in the mirror are deleted, and data copying from the master journal to the restore journal stops. Specify one of the following deletion modes when deleting a mirror:
Normal: The mirror is deleted only when the primary system can change the mirror status to Initial.
Force: The mirror is forcibly deleted even when the primary system cannot communicate with the secondary system.
If the mirror status does not change to Initial after 5 or more minutes from when you start an operation to delete a mirror in Force mode, restart the delete operation in Force mode to ensure all pairs in the mirror are deleted.
After each delete operation in Force mode, wait at least five minutes before you create pairs in the same journal. Otherwise the paircreate operation might fail.
